There's been a recent revival (for better or worse) of fashion from the 2000s so it kind of makes sense there's some buzz around skinny jeans.
I recently read a quote from the CEO of Levis who said the re-emergence of the style will look and feel different. That's usually the case when trends and styles from the past re-emerge. It's an improved version - thankfully.
The rejigged skinny leg look will be less tight, specifically around the calf and ankle. It's like it's borrowing a little from the straight leg and capri pant.
Having said that skinnys will be coming back, I think it's safe to say the wide leg isn't going anywhere. I mean what started as a straight leg jean, moved to wide leg, then to super wide leg (not the official term but I have seen jeans and pants get baggier and more loose fitting). As I mentioned, the less clingy fit is comfortable and works just as well with tees and tanks, blazers and cardigans, jumpers and knits.

In terms of what other trends we'll be seeing over the next few months, there'll be a lot of crochet, sheer fabrics and lace, off shoulder tops and a dominant colours will be a deep maroon or wine and chocolate brown in everything from skirts to tops and shoes. Iām also seeing some chatter over shoulder bags vs crossbody bags or ones with longer straps. Think of this one as like the ankle/hidden socks vs crew sock debate. A crossbody bag shows your age - apparently.
